The King has approved the appointment of Crown Advocate Hilary Pullum as His Majesty's Comptroller in Guernsey.
In her new role Ms Pullum will provide legal services and advice for the Crown, the States of Guernsey, the States of Alderney and the Chief Please of Sark.
Ms Pullum succeeds Robert Tittering KC who has retired after almost nine years in the role.
She said: ''Having served the Bailiwick as one of the lawyers within the Chambers of the Law Officers of the Crown since 2007, it is a privilege to be appointed as His Majesty's Comptroller and I will look forward to continuing to serve the Bailiwick in this post."
